What Does “Register Your Business on ChatGPT” Really Mean?
Many business owners assume there is a direct form to submit their company to ChatGPT. In reality, register your business on ChatGPT means making your business information available through reliable, structured, and authoritative online sources that AI models can access and understand.
ChatGPT relies on:
-
Publicly available websites
-
Trusted directories and platforms
-
Structured data and schema
-
High-quality, informative content
Your goal is to help AI clearly understand who you are, what you offer, and why your business is relevant.

Step-by-Step Guide to Register Your Business on ChatGPT
Step 1: Develop a Clear, Trustworthy Website
Your website is the foundation of ChatGPT recognition. Make sure it includes:
-
Clear brand identity and messaging
-
Detailed service or product descriptions
-
Contact details and business location
-
An “About” page highlighting experience and expertise
Use simple, human-friendly language so AI can easily interpret your content.
Step 2: Implement Structured Data (Schema Markup)
Structured data helps AI systems understand your business precisely. Add:
-
Organization schema
-
Local Business schema (if applicable)
-
Product or Service schema
This step significantly improves how ChatGPT categorizes and references your business.
Step 3: Strengthen Your Online Presence
The ChatGPT submit business process depends heavily on consistency across platforms. Ensure your business is accurately listed on:
-
Google Business Profile
-
Industry-specific directories
-
Social media business pages
-
Review and listing websites
Consistency in name, address, phone number, and services is critical.
Step 4: Publish Helpful, In-Depth Content
Content is one of the strongest signals for AI understanding. To register your business on ChatGPT effectively, publish:
-
Educational blog posts
-
How-to guides
-
FAQs answering common customer questions
-
Industry insights and case studies
The more value your content provides, the more likely ChatGPT is to reference your brand.
Step 5: Build Authority Through Mentions
When reputable websites mention or link to your business, it boosts credibility. Press coverage, guest articles, partnerships, and citations all help strengthen your AI visibility.
Authoritative mentions signal to ChatGPT that your business is trusted and relevant.
Step 6: Keep Information Updated and Accurate
AI relies on current data. Regularly review and update:
-
Business hours
-
Services and offerings
-
Contact information
-
Locations and expansions
Outdated details can limit your chances of being recommended by ChatGPT.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. Can I directly submit my business to ChatGPT?
There is no direct submission form. The ChatGPT submit business process happens through optimized websites, structured data, and trusted sources.
2. Is it free to register a business on ChatGPT?
Yes, most steps are organic and free, though professional SEO support can speed up results.
